WebMar 25, 2024 · A data type is a set of values, and the allowable operations on those values. The two fundamental data types in C# are value types and reference types. Primitive types (except strings), enumerations, tuples, and structures are value types. Classes, records, strings, interfaces, arrays, and delegates are reference types.
